To Find a lost Android phone / Erase data/ activate Lock / make ringing , the lost Android device must:

1, Be Powered on,
2, Have Location turned on

3, Have Find My Device turned on,

Select your choice Lock / Erase / Ring / X / ,
If it's already locked, you will not see New  Lock options,

If a Lock Screen is Set up for Device,
Device will be locked with this passcode,
Once locked, It's not possible to Remove or Override this Lock  with another Code through Find my device,




It's possible to change / Override Lock Screen message through Find my device,

You can Erase Data even though Find my device and Location is turned off,
